Administers customer service accounts of moderate scope and complexity to achieve division business objectives and to meet customer performance expectations. Develops solutions for customer needs and works to maximize sales and profits while defending current business.

  • Formulate goals and objectives to improve the customer experience for key accounts and develop methods to grow business year over year.

  • Answer customer inquiries and requests regarding accounts, products, pricing, and services offered.

  • Enter/release orders for customer accounts via manual, electronic, or customers portals and provide confirmations. Scan and index orders into Application Extender once complete.

  • Review terms and conditions of customer orders for compliance and refers those that are unacceptable to management for resolution.

  • Follow up with customer accounts with any issues, concerns or delay with customer orders

  • Act as primary point of contact for assigned customer accounts and coordinate with Planning, Production, Quality, Materials and Sales to deliver a premier customer experience.

  • Request ATR's (Authorization to Return) CAR's, PAR's and customer complaints from Quality Department

  • Communicate all pertinent customer expedite or changes to order to supply chain or scheduling concerning schedule changes.

  • Issue credits and add bills, works with accounting to help resolve payment issues.

  • Perform customer service essential job functions to advance our Corporate LTR/Composite Scores

  • Drive continuous improvement in daily activities and exceed customer expectations with their customer experience

  • Other duties as assigned.

  • High School education

  • 3-5 years' experience in customer service, ideally in manufacturing/OEM/distribution.

  • Advanced computer skills: experience with ERP systems, order portals, and Application Extender preferred.

  • Excellent verbal, written, and interpersonal communication skills.

  • Strong problem solving, attention to detail, and ability to coordinate across functions.
